Output 34eba08b6fd78a97a5e54eebf1e63cdfc8b725877f3c6000b486d1cd4c90555f:1

value
2996062
script pubkey
OP_0 OP_PUSHBYTES_20 1ccdfa56d2d1acbfcbb15d2e5e9c1558074f6cac
address
bc1qrnxl54kj6xktlja3t5h9a8q4tqr57m9vl6fwfl
transaction
34eba08b6fd78a97a5e54eebf1e63cdfc8b725877f3c6000b486d1cd4c90555f
confirmations
1130
spent
true